Transaction 6281539151c918029184cf1546351636f017b10635bb7fa210803084d42e3df9
1 Input
2 Outputs
- 6281539151c918029184cf1546351636f017b10635bb7fa210803084d42e3df9:0
- 6281539151c918029184cf1546351636f017b10635bb7fa210803084d42e3df9:1
value 14631899
address 39xmUutMc1imUMb9Nin6yVRr31iFrXKpMZ
value 960755506
address 3NPwWaG76rzWTQMVn1v8vToUcNawXvEFsH